Community water supplies are water supplies that are reticulated across a property boundary. The water supply can be council or community owned. They range in size from:

  • large (for more than 10,000 people)
  • medium (for 5001-10,000 people)
  • minor (for 501-5000 people)
  • small (for 101-500 people)
  • neighbourhood (25-100 people)
  • rural/agricultural (where more than 75 per cent of the water can be proven as used for agriculture).
